Vogts worries about preparations
By Oluwashina Okeleji
BBC Sport, Lagos

Nigeria's German coach Berti Vogts
Berti Vogts is worried about Nigeria's preparations for the Nations Cup

Nigeria coach Berti Vogts says the Super Eagles' hopes of preparing properly for the next African Cup of Nations finals are already being undermined by poor organisation.

The Super Eagles were due to play Togo on Tuesday in a friendly, but the match was cancelled just before Nigeria's Nation's Cup qualifier against Lesotho on Saturday.

A furious Vogts says that attitudes have to change given the importance of preparation ahead of the Nations Cup finals in Ghana in January.

"I am not happy about it because I need these friendly matches to prepare my team," Vogts said.

The German coach said that a general apathy towards the national team, especially from the Nigerian FA, is hindering the progress of the Super Eagles.

"I am very unhappy the match was cancelled and the international department (of the NFA) should know why," he added.

"I proposed two friendly matches myself, but now this one have been cancelled. This is not funny.

"I am now looking out to play two friendly matches in October and November."

Meanwhile, Vogts says he was impressed with his new addition to the Super Eagles debutants on Saturday, Richard Eromoigbe and Ikechukwu Uche.

The duo came on as second half substitute in the 2-0 win over Lesotho, with Uche getting a goal on 75 minutes leaving Vogts a happy man.

"We need a pool of between twenty five and twenty seven players because we cannot play the nation's cup with eleven or eighteen players so we will keep inviting new people until we get twenty five we can really on," he said.

Everton striker Victor Anichebe is one of those few still waiting for their first Nigerian cap as he was ruled out of Saturday's qualifier due to injury.
